Taxonomic Classification

Rank Boreal Bluet Cuvier s Spiny-rat
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Arthropoda (Arthropods)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Insecta (Insects)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Odonata (Odonata) Rodentia (Rodents)
Family Coenagrionidae Echimyidae
Genus Enallagma Proechimys
Species Enallagma boreale Proechimys cuvieri

Evolutionary Relationship

Boreal Bluet and Cuvier s Spiny-rat share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
